What is Ecommerce Software?
Ecommerce software is a platform or application that allows businesses to manage their online store operations, such as product listings, sales transactions, payments, shipping, and customer data. It typically includes tools for website design, inventory management, customer support, and marketing. Choosing the right ecommerce software helps businesses efficiently manage these components while offering a seamless shopping experience for customers.
Key Features of Ecommerce Software
-
User-Friendly Interface One of the most important factors to consider when selecting ecommerce software is the user interface. A simple and intuitive interface makes it easier to manage your online store, even if you don’t have technical expertise. The best ecommerce software provides drag-and-drop design tools, allowing you to customize your store’s look without needing to code.
-
Mobile Responsiveness With the increasing use of mobile devices for online shopping, your ecommerce software must be mobile-responsive. A mobile-friendly website ensures your store looks great and functions properly on smartphones and tablets, providing an optimal shopping experience for mobile users.
-
Payment Gateway Integration Ecommerce software should seamlessly integrate with popular payment gateways like PayPal, Stripe, or credit card processors. This integration allows you to accept secure payments from customers worldwide. Additionally, it’s important to choose ecommerce software that complies with industry standards for data security, such as SSL certificates, to protect sensitive customer information.
-
Inventory and Order Management Efficient inventory and order management tools are essential for smooth operations. The best ecommerce software helps you track stock levels in real-time, manage product variants (such as size and color), and automatically update your inventory when items are sold. This reduces the risk of overselling and ensures that customers always have accurate information about product availability.
-
SEO Tools Search engine optimization (SEO) is critical for driving organic traffic to your online store. Many ecommerce software platforms come with built-in SEO tools that help you optimize product pages, images, and content for better visibility on search engines. Key SEO features include customizable meta titles, descriptions, and URL slugs, as well as options for adding alt text to images.
-
Customer Support Features Customer support is vital for maintaining a good relationship with your buyers. Good ecommerce software often includes built-in support features, such as live chat, help desks, and ticketing systems, allowing you to quickly respond to customer inquiries and resolve issues efficiently.
-
Scalability As your business grows, your ecommerce software should be able to scale with you. Choose a platform that offers flexible pricing plans, additional features, and apps to support your expansion. Whether you're adding new products, opening additional sales channels, or expanding internationally, your ecommerce software should be adaptable to meet your needs.
-
Marketing Tools Marketing is essential for driving traffic and sales to your online store. Most ecommerce software platforms come with built-in marketing tools, such as email marketing integration, social media sharing options, and promotions like discount codes and coupons. These features help you attract new customers, retain existing ones, and increase your sales.
Popular Types of Ecommerce Software
-
Hosted Ecommerce Platforms Hosted ecommerce software platforms, such as Shopify and BigCommerce, provide everything you need to run your store, from website hosting to payment processing. They are user-friendly, offer a range of templates, and include hosting as part of their service. Hosted platforms are ideal for those looking for an all-in-one solution without dealing with technical details.
-
Self-Hosted Ecommerce Platforms Self-hosted ecommerce software, like WooCommerce (for WordPress) and Magento, gives you more control over your online store. You’ll need to handle hosting and technical aspects, but this type of software offers more customization options and scalability. Self-hosted platforms are best for businesses with specific needs and technical resources.
-
Open-Source Ecommerce Software Open-source ecommerce software provides complete freedom and flexibility to developers. Popular options like PrestaShop and OpenCart allow you to modify the code to fit your exact requirements. While this option offers great customization, it requires technical expertise to set up and maintain.
Choosing the Right Ecommerce Software for Your Business
When choosing ecommerce software, consider your business needs, budget, and level of technical expertise. If you're a beginner or small business owner, hosted platforms like Shopify or Wix are great options. However, if you need advanced customization or have a larger budget, self-hosted or open-source solutions like WooCommerce or Magento may be more suitable.
Also, consider factors like customer support, ease of use, integrations with other tools (such as accounting or inventory management software), and scalability for future growth. Your goal is to find ecommerce software that supports your current needs and can grow with your business.
